Are you eager to twirl the reels and seek that huge win? The world of online casinos is teeming with options, making it tricky to discover the greatest sites. That's where we step in. Our team of veterans has investigated the digital landscape to bring you with a handpicked list of the leading online casinos. Individual site on our directory is m